Protein Coding Gene : Wap whey acidic protein

Primary Identifier  MGI:98943 Organism  mouse, laboratory
Chromosome  11 NCBI Gene Number  22373
Mgi Type  protein coding gene
description  FUNCTION: Automated description from the Alliance of Genome Resources (Release 7.1.0)

Enables nutrient reservoir activity. Predicted to be involved in antibacterial humoral response and innate immune response. Located in extracellular region. Is expressed in mammary gland.
PHENOTYPE: Homozygous mutants are phenotypically normal and fertile. Functional differentiation of mammary epithelium is normal and dams produce milk, but pups thrive poorly on milk lacking whey acidic protein. A normal variant determines a one amino acid change inWAP protein in YBR versus other strains. [provided by MGI curators]
